Great playing! For the main riff, are you trying to touch the strings against the pickup to make the weird high sound?

5

u/LordWorm Sep 24 '24

So I actually had to watch the way Steeve did this in a blurry ass live video to tell what he was actually doing to produce that sound. Basically what you do is you hold the pick as perpendicular to the strings as you can, and smash it straight down onto one of the places there's a harmonic node. If you don't hit the harmonic node, you won't get anywhere near as much of a sound.
